I was going to try to post it, but it doesn't appear to be available on YT at the moment. It's one of those Happy Harmonies cartoons made in the '30's. A pharmacist falls asleep one night and has a nightmare where all the bottles of products in the store come alive. Pretty neat. There is a similar one set in a bookshop where the books come alive, but I can't remember the title of that one. I'd like to find it.
